Tim Robishaw wrote:
I'm trying to use comment-region to turn a few paragraphs into
comments. However, after marking the region and applying
comment-region, the blank lines are NOT commented. I'd like to use
the "plain" comment-style I tried all the others and while some of
them produce commented blank lines [aligned/box/box-multi do,
plain/indent/multi-line/extra-line do not], these also produce comment
characters at the end of each line, which I don't want. Any help
would be hugely appreciated! Best -Tim.
,----[ C-h v comment-empty-lines RET ]
| comment-empty-lines is a variable defined in `newcomment.el'.
| Its value is nil
|
| Documentation:
| If nil, `comment-region' does not comment out empty lines.
| If t, it always comments out empty lines.
| if `eol' it only comments out empty lines if comments are
| terminated by the end of line (i.e. `comment-end' is empty).
|
| You can customize this variable.
